Why Use an SEO Plugin for WordPress?

Before looking at the best plugins, it helps to understand why they matter.

An SEO plugin helps you optimize your website without needing advanced technical knowledge. Instead of manually handling metadata, sitemaps, redirects, schema, and keyword optimization, a plugin streamlines these tasks.

Better On-Page Optimization

SEO plugins help optimize title tags, meta descriptions, keyword usage, heading structures, internal linking, and content readability. These elements help search engines understand your content and improve user experience.

Technical SEO Support

Many plugins handle complex tasks such as XML sitemap creation, canonical URLs, robots.txt control, redirect management, schema markup, and broken link monitoring. These technical factors influence how search engines crawl and index your website.

Improved Search Visibility

Well-optimized pages have a stronger chance of ranking higher, attracting more clicks, and generating organic traffic.

Time Savings

Instead of manually handling dozens of SEO tasks, plugins automate much of the work.

Yoast SEO

Key Features

On-Page SEO Analysis

Yoast analyzes content and provides recommendations for improving keyword placement, meta titles, descriptions, internal links, and overall content structure. Its traffic light system makes optimization easy to understand.

Readability Analysis

Yoast checks sentence length, passive voice, transition words, and paragraph structure to improve content quality and user engagement.

XML Sitemap Generation

The plugin automatically creates XML sitemaps to help search engines crawl your site efficiently.

Schema Markup

Built-in structured data support helps improve rich search results.

Redirect Management

Premium versions include redirect tools for managing broken URLs and protecting rankings.

Best For

Yoast SEO is ideal for beginners, bloggers, small businesses, and content-heavy websites.

Rank Math

Key Features

Advanced SEO Setup Wizard

Rank Math simplifies setup with guided configuration for sitemap settings, schema, and search engine visibility.

Keyword Optimization

It supports multiple focus keywords, allowing broader search targeting.

Built-In Schema Generator

Supports article, product, FAQ, recipe, review, and local business schema.

Google Search Console Integration

Provides keyword rankings, impressions, clicks, and index data directly in WordPress.

Redirection Manager

Includes built-in tools to manage redirects and fix broken links.

Best For

Great for advanced users, bloggers, agencies, and ecommerce websites.

All in One SEO (AIOSEO)

Key Features

TruSEO On-Page Analysis

Offers recommendations for keywords, titles, meta descriptions, and content structure.

Smart XML Sitemaps

Generates standard, news, video, and RSS sitemaps.

Local SEO Features

Strong tools for businesses targeting local search traffic.

WooCommerce SEO

Helps optimize product pages for online stores.

Schema Support

Structured data support improves rich snippet opportunities.

Best For

Best for beginners, small businesses, ecommerce sites, and local businesses.

SEOPress

Key Features

Metadata Management

Manage titles, descriptions, social metadata, and Open Graph settings.

XML and HTML Sitemaps

Supports multiple sitemap formats for better indexing.

Content Analysis

Evaluates optimization opportunities for on-page SEO.

Schema and Rich Snippets

Strong structured data support for publishers.

Google Analytics Integration

Connect analytics without needing separate plugins.

White Label Option

Useful for agencies managing client websites.

Best For

Ideal for developers, agencies, publishers, and budget-conscious users.

The SEO Framework

Key Features

Lightweight Design

A minimal plugin that avoids feature bloat and supports site speed.

Automated SEO Settings

Handles many optimization tasks automatically.

Metadata Optimization

Manages titles and descriptions intelligently.

Spam-Free Interface

No ads or upsells cluttering the dashboard.

Best For

Perfect for minimalist users, developers, and performance-focused websites.

Can You Use Multiple SEO Plugins?

Generally, no. Using multiple full SEO plugins can cause conflicts, duplicate metadata, and schema issues. One primary SEO plugin is usually enough.

Free vs Premium SEO Plugins

Free versions are often sufficient for small websites, while premium plans may include advanced schema, redirect managers, local SEO tools, AI recommendations, and premium support.

Common SEO Plugin Mistakes to Avoid

Avoid keyword stuffing, ignoring technical errors, over-optimizing content, using multiple SEO plugins at once, and assuming plugins replace a full SEO strategy.
